Beetlejuice Beetlejuice has confirmed a streaming release in the US.
In this new version, we find ourselves delving into the highly anticipated continuation of Tim Burton’s 1988 dark fantasy film. The iconic characters played by Michael Keaton (as our titular poltergeist), Winona Ryder (Lydia Deetz), and Catherine O’Hara (Delia Deetz) make their return to the screen. Joining this stellar cast is Jenna Ortega, who takes on the role of Lydia’s teenage daughter named Astrid in the storyline.
Starting from December 6th, the movie which was screened in cinemas in September, will be accessible for streaming in the US via Max. As for the UK, the film will stream on Sky, but the specific date remains undisclosed at this time.
In the sequel, set years later since the initial film, a family tragedy brings Delia, Lydia, and Astrid back to their old residence at Winter River.

Whenever someone calls out the name of Betelgeuse thrice, a trickster spirit cannot resist but come back with a grin, ready to wreak havoc in its unique and chaotic style.
The ensemble also features Justin Theroux, Monica Bellucci, Willem Dafoe, Burn Gorman, Danny DeVito, as well as Arthur Conti, who is known for his role in ‘House of the Dragon’.
The movie “Beetlejuice Beetlejuice” made its entrance with an impressive 76% rating labeled as ‘Certified Fresh’ on the review platform Rotten Tomatoes. However, it narrowly missed surpassing the initial film’s score of 82%.

According to Digital Spy’s critique, we noted that the movie “Beetlejuice Beetlejuice” effectively maintains the eccentric essence of the original film, although not every brilliant concept it introduces fully materializes.
Beginning December 6th, “Beetlejuice” can be streamed on Max in the US. Meanwhile, the movie is currently available for purchase or rental via Amazon Prime Video, iTunes, Microsoft Store, and other platforms in the UK.
